Sony would like to point out to installers that if the indications contained in this guide are not respected, there may be a
significant impact on the system performance.
Sony would also like to point out to installers that a well-performing system can only be achieved on number plates which are:
Clean and in good condition.
Conform to the regulations.
However, although the system can be used on all types of plates, the performance is significantly reduced on:
The rear plates (because of the possible presence on the rear of the vehicle of elements which may hinder plate
localisation or recognition). This applies in particular to lorries.
Plates which, although conform to regulations, have small-sized characters (especially motorbike plates).
Plates which, although conform to regulations for old vehicles in certain countries, are not reflective to infrared (are
only read if there is enough natural or artificial illumination to compensate for the lack of response to the infra-red
illumination of the camera).
Plates which, although conform to regulations, contain atypical syntaxes (usually purchased by the owners of the
vehicles) with just three or four characters.
The system doesn't work in theses cases:
Square licence plates.
Non IR reflective license plates.
If all the number plates in the fleet do not entirely correspond to these criteria, regardless of the country concerned, a reading
result of 100% can never be attained.
